Dragons have been a part of mythology for thousands of years, and stories about them are filled with thrills and danger. The heroic epic of Beowulf and the Dragon is featured in graphic-novel style, using detailed artwork to draw even the most reluctant readers into the world of these powerful mythical creatures.
